What are Crypto Stablecoins?
Crypto stablecoins act much like national currencies, offering stability through pegged values. Think of them as digital currency reserves, similar to having cash in a bank, providing a secure way to transact in the volatile crypto environment.
Types of Stablecoins
- Fiat-collateralized: Backed by traditional currencies like USD.
- Crypto-collateralized: Backed by cryptocurrency assets.
- Algorithmic: Uses algorithms to control the supply.
